Q:   What are the best things to do on weekends as a student at Florida Institute of Technology?
A: 

Florida Institute of Technology is situated in the beautiful city of Melbourne, Florida, United States and there's a lot to do apart from studying in the university. Mentioned below are some of the best things to do on weekends as a student at Florida Tech:

  • University is an hour and 30 minute drive from Orlando if students want to visit the theme parks or a bigger city  
  • Go out for Karaoke nights, bowling, movies, and more;
  • Volunteer at animal shelters, community service, and help tend to public events;
  • Visit places that hold historical values, churches and more;
  • Get to know the people around; and
  • Participate in co-curricular activities on campus.
  • University is about 10 minutes from the beach and very close to Downtown Melbourne offerinf various restaurants.

Q:   Which majors is Florida Institute of Technology known for?
A: 

Florida Institute of Technology majors are available in more than 200 undergraduate,  35 graduate degree and certificate programs in leading fields such as Science, Engineering, Aeronautics, Business, Psychology, and Communication. Listed below are some of the most popular Florida Tech programs for international students:

Florida Tech CoursesPercentage of Enrollment
Aerospace, Aeronautical & Astronautical/Space Engineering11.8%
Aeronautics/Aviation/Aerospace Science & Technology11.2%
Mechanical Engineering10.5%
Computer Science5.8%
Ocean Engineering4.6%

 

Q:   What is the Florida Institute of Technology acceptance rate?
A: 

Based on the ratio of admissions to applications, the Florida Institute of Technology acceptance rate stands at 66%. Since, the stats are on the higher end, we can conclude that Florida Tech is a not a very competitive university to get in, as it admits more than half of the applicants. Once an applicant fulfills the Florida Tech admission requirements, ie; competitive grades, standardized test scores, English language requirements, as well as relevant documents, they are most likely to secure an admission in the university. However, students must not take this lightly and apply to Florida Institute of Technology within the deadlines in order to get enrolled as a student.

Note: The data has been derived from unofficial sources and is subjected to changes.

Would definitely recommend! Sweet people and nice faculty.
Tips: The location isn’t really how an Indian would typically think of “America”, but don’t let this stop you since there are a lot of opportunities here if you’re willing to work hard. There’s Space Coast nearby making a huge job opportunity for post-graduation.
Likes (Post study jobs): I have seen a lot of my peers getting jobs here (both international and US nationals) and settling. There’s a huge job opportunity here because of a lot of industries operating. Companies do not hesitate to offer H1-B visa to Florida Tech graduates.
Dislikes (Public transportation): Since the university is in a sub-urban setting, there aren’t many places of interest here, leading to less public transport. But, this really isn’t a problem because everything is close by. You can find all sorts of food on campus itself and all the gear you will ever need throughout your college life.

Highlights

  • This program offers a student the opportunity to pursue advanced studies in various areas of computer science
  • The program is designed for students with bachelor's degrees in computer science and provides a solid preparation for those who may pursue a doctorate
  • Master's students are encouraged to concentrate their studies in research areas of interest to faculty in the department
  • Graduates with a master's degree in computer science find employment opportunities in nearly every market segment as technology expands into every aspect of our lives: work, home, social and recreation
